Transaction 32dc3140c77933ee9849ff3ac0c5246f12f6c8b3a0d67bb25eb25d51a543e170

1 Input
2 Outputs
  • 32dc3140c77933ee9849ff3ac0c5246f12f6c8b3a0d67bb25eb25d51a543e170:0
  • value  966000
    address  34DLTWA2YzKYwByqKgLQYxfRi4kNhFKhhx
  • 32dc3140c77933ee9849ff3ac0c5246f12f6c8b3a0d67bb25eb25d51a543e170:1
  • value  2847367
    address  38Xi2R6Jgz6MkUffH1D22xAzWcwnoSusXp